The ENFP and ESTP personality types, both part of the Myers-Briggs Type Indicator (MBTI), create a unique bond characterized by a dynamic interplay of ideas and action. This article explores the synergy between these two types, how they complement each other, and the potential challenges they may face in their relationship.
Understanding ENFPs and ESTPs
ENFPs, known as the “Campaigners,” are enthusiastic, creative, and deeply empathetic. They thrive on exploring new ideas and possibilities, often driven by their values and a desire to connect with others. On the other hand, ESTPs, referred to as the “Entrepreneurs,” are action-oriented, pragmatic, and spontaneous. They enjoy living in the moment and often take risks to achieve their goals.
Key Characteristics of ENFPs
- Highly imaginative and innovative.
- Value emotional connections and authenticity.
- Enjoy brainstorming and exploring new concepts.
- Adaptable and flexible in their approach to life.
Key Characteristics of ESTPs
- Practical and results-driven.
- Enjoy hands-on experiences and challenges.
- Quick decision-makers who thrive in fast-paced environments.
- Have a keen sense of adventure and spontaneity.
The Dynamic Between ENFPs and ESTPs
The bond between ENFPs and ESTPs is often electrifying. Their differences can lead to a complementary relationship where ideas meet action, creating a dynamic partnership. ENFPs bring creativity and vision, while ESTPs provide the energy and decisiveness to bring those ideas to life.
Strengths of the ENFP-ESTP Bond
- Mutual encouragement to step outside comfort zones.
- ENFPs inspire ESTPs to consider deeper meanings and possibilities.
- ESTPs help ENFPs take actionable steps toward their dreams.
- Shared love for adventure and new experiences.
Challenges in the ENFP-ESTP Relationship
- Different approaches to decision-making can cause friction.
- ENFPs may feel overwhelmed by ESTPs’ impulsiveness.
- ESTPs might find ENFPs’ emotional depth challenging to navigate.
- Potential for misunderstandings due to differing priorities.
Strategies for Strengthening the ENFP-ESTP Bond
To cultivate a thriving relationship, both ENFPs and ESTPs can implement several strategies that leverage their strengths while addressing their challenges.
Effective Communication
Open and honest communication is vital. ENFPs should express their feelings and ideas clearly, while ESTPs should share their thoughts and decisions without hesitation. Regular check-ins can help both types stay connected and aligned.
Balancing Ideas and Action
ENFPs can benefit from ESTPs’ practicality by setting tangible goals for their ideas. Conversely, ESTPs can learn to appreciate the value of brainstorming and reflection that ENFPs offer, allowing for a more rounded approach to problem-solving.
Embracing Differences
Recognizing and embracing their differences can strengthen the bond. ENFPs should respect ESTPs’ need for spontaneity, while ESTPs should honor ENFPs’ emotional insights. Celebrating these unique traits can lead to a deeper understanding and appreciation of each other.
